Large morays occupy the deeper cave entrances and boulder piles, sometimes reaching 1.3 metres in length. They are highly site-faithful, returning to the same dens for years and acting as top ambush predators of the resident fish community. Cleaner wrasse stations near their lairs are a reliable sighting cue.
